欧美一级特黄大片做受成人-亚洲成人一区二区电影-激情熟女一区二区三区-日韩专区欧美专区国产专区

SQLite數(shù)據(jù)庫(kù)怎么移植

這篇文章主要講解了“SQLite數(shù)據(jù)庫(kù)怎么移植”,文中的講解內(nèi)容簡(jiǎn)單清晰,易于學(xué)習(xí)與理解,下面請(qǐng)大家跟著小編的思路慢慢深入,一起來(lái)研究和學(xué)習(xí)“SQLite數(shù)據(jù)庫(kù)怎么移植”吧!

10多年建站經(jīng)驗(yàn), 網(wǎng)站建設(shè)、成都網(wǎng)站建設(shè)客戶的見(jiàn)證與正確選擇。創(chuàng)新互聯(lián)建站提供完善的營(yíng)銷型網(wǎng)頁(yè)建站明細(xì)報(bào)價(jià)表。后期開(kāi)發(fā)更加便捷高效,我們致力于追求更美、更快、更規(guī)范。

在掛有小型系統(tǒng)的嵌入式產(chǎn)品中,移植SQLite數(shù)據(jù)庫(kù)就是一項(xiàng)必須的工作。以下是針對(duì)arm-linux-gcc的arm產(chǎn)品來(lái)移植SQLite數(shù)據(jù)庫(kù)的步驟詳解,在移植之前,請(qǐng)先確保arm-linux-gcc編譯是安裝正常的,這點(diǎn)非常重要。

SQLite,是一款輕型的數(shù)據(jù)庫(kù),是遵守ACID的關(guān)系型數(shù)據(jù)庫(kù)管理系統(tǒng),它包含在一個(gè)相對(duì)小的C庫(kù)中。它是D.RichardHipp建立的公有領(lǐng)域項(xiàng)目。它的設(shè)計(jì)目標(biāo)是嵌入式的,而且目前已經(jīng)在很多嵌入式產(chǎn)品中使用了它,它占用資源非常的低,在嵌入式設(shè)備中,可能只需要幾百K的內(nèi)存就夠了。

Sqlite官網(wǎng)網(wǎng)址:https://www.sqlite.org/

1、將sqlite-autoconf-3090200.tar.gz安裝包放到一個(gè)路徑下面,并將tar -xf  sqlite-autoconf-3090200.tar.gz解壓

SQLite數(shù)據(jù)庫(kù)怎么移植

2、建立sqlite的空文件夾

SQLite數(shù)據(jù)庫(kù)怎么移植

3、進(jìn)入剛解壓的文件夾sqlite-autoconf-3090200,并執(zhí)行配置命令 ./configure --host=arm-linux  --prefix=/opt/toolschain/sqlite

SQLite數(shù)據(jù)庫(kù)怎么移植

4、執(zhí)行make命令

SQLite數(shù)據(jù)庫(kù)怎么移植

5、執(zhí)行make install命令

SQLite數(shù)據(jù)庫(kù)怎么移植

6、完成之后,到剛才新建的sqlite數(shù)據(jù)庫(kù)看一下,是否生成一些文件夾

SQLite數(shù)據(jù)庫(kù)怎么移植

7、Bin文件夾

SQLite數(shù)據(jù)庫(kù)怎么移植

注意:Bin文件夾下有個(gè)sqlite3這個(gè)文件,當(dāng)?shù)腶rm開(kāi)發(fā)板要用sqlite數(shù)據(jù)庫(kù)時(shí),將這個(gè)文件復(fù)制到開(kāi)發(fā)板下面即可,一般的路徑是是在文件系統(tǒng)下的/user/bin下面,也有其他的路徑,視情況而定。

8、Lib文件夾

SQLite數(shù)據(jù)庫(kù)怎么移植

注意:這些都是一些庫(kù)連接文件了,將這些文件全部復(fù)制到開(kāi)發(fā)板的文件系統(tǒng)的/user/lib下面,也有其他路徑,視情況而定。

9、Include文件夾

SQLite數(shù)據(jù)庫(kù)怎么移植

這個(gè)文件夾下面的sqlite3.h就是我們應(yīng)用程序要使用的文件了,在要操作數(shù)據(jù)庫(kù)時(shí),將這個(gè)文件包含進(jìn)來(lái)即可,比如我的項(xiàng)目下面就包含了這個(gè)文件了。

SQLite數(shù)據(jù)庫(kù)怎么移植

10、由于我的項(xiàng)目使用的靜態(tài)庫(kù)連接,看makefile

SQLite數(shù)據(jù)庫(kù)怎么移植

所以需要將生成文件lib下面的libsqlite3.a復(fù)制到我的項(xiàng)目文件夾下面,如果使用動(dòng)態(tài)的就不需要了,注意一下

SQLite數(shù)據(jù)庫(kù)怎么移植

11、編譯項(xiàng)目

當(dāng)編譯項(xiàng)目時(shí)出現(xiàn)了一序列的錯(cuò)誤,都找不到該函數(shù)

SQLite數(shù)據(jù)庫(kù)怎么移植

這個(gè)問(wèn)題的解決方法是:在編譯時(shí)加上-ldl即可

SQLite數(shù)據(jù)庫(kù)怎么移植

SQLite數(shù)據(jù)庫(kù)怎么移植

12、Sqlite制作成功,這個(gè)是arm-linux平臺(tái)的,其他平臺(tái)的移植類似,successfully!!!……

13、Sqlite常用基本命令

新建數(shù)據(jù)庫(kù)

sqlite3 databasefilename

插入記錄

insert into table_name values (field1, field2, field3...);

查詢

select * from table_name;查看table_name表中所有記錄;

select * from table_name where field1='xxxxx'; 查詢符合指定條件的記錄;

刪除

delete from table_name where ...

刪除表

drop table_name; 刪除表;

drop index_name; 刪除索引;

修改

update table_name set xxx=value[, xxx=value,...] where ...

輸出 HTML 表格:

sqlite3 -html film.db "select * from film;"

感謝各位的閱讀,以上就是“SQLite數(shù)據(jù)庫(kù)怎么移植”的內(nèi)容了,經(jīng)過(guò)本文的學(xué)習(xí)后,相信大家對(duì)SQLite數(shù)據(jù)庫(kù)怎么移植這一問(wèn)題有了更深刻的體會(huì),具體使用情況還需要大家實(shí)踐驗(yàn)證。這里是創(chuàng)新互聯(lián),小編將為大家推送更多相關(guān)知識(shí)點(diǎn)的文章,歡迎關(guān)注!

網(wǎng)頁(yè)題目:SQLite數(shù)據(jù)庫(kù)怎么移植
瀏覽路徑:http://aaarwkj.com/article14/gjghde.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供定制網(wǎng)站外貿(mào)建站、營(yíng)銷型網(wǎng)站建設(shè)商城網(wǎng)站、自適應(yīng)網(wǎng)站網(wǎng)站排名

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來(lái)源: 創(chuàng)新互聯(lián)

成都網(wǎng)站建設(shè)
日韩丰满少妇在线观看| 麻豆视频91免费观看| 高潮少妇高潮少妇av| 日本熟熟妇丰满人妻啪啪| 国产夫妻自拍一级黄片| 国产三级无遮挡在线观看| 真做的欧美三级在线观看| 韩国三级福利在线观看| 末满18周岁禁止观看| 国产手机在线91精品观看| 欧美日韩福利一区二区三区| 色呦呦视频在线免费观看| 人妻内射一区二区在线视| 岛国高清乱码中文字幕| 福利在线午夜绝顶三级| 日本高清精品视频免费| 国产日韩欧美亚洲一区二区| 免费午夜福利一区二区| 国产一区二区精品小视频| 日韩国产一区二区在线观看| 91九色在线视频观看| 国产视频在线一区二区| 91久久精品凹凸一区二区| av在线中文字幕乱码| 成人av男人天堂东京热| 亚洲第一国产综合自拍| 欧美一级黄色免费电影| 日本丝袜福利在线观看| 国产精品日韩欧美一区二区| 99精品国产综合久久麻豆| 蜜桃视频在线视频免费观看| 亚洲高清无毛一区二区| 国产91黑丝视频在线观看| 国产精品一二三在线看| 五月婷婷六月丁香免费视频| 麻豆资源视频在线观看| 少妇视频资源一区二区三区| 一区二区三区日韩激情| 久久亚洲一本综合久久| 免费福利激情在线播放| 日韩人妻熟妇中文字幕|